你查询的IP:[121.4.42.52]  地理位置:中国–上海–上海

最新查询202.91.224.34 121.68.216.73 218.56.102.210 122.96.171.111 123.8.4.178 123.98.132.136 159.226.198.253 119.112.155.21 124.112.196.80 121.4.42.52 124.66.167.9 119.15.136.156 202.96.163.236 119.19.188.192 202.38.149.13 202.127.112.35 124.16.48.161 203.166.160.228 202.148.96.113 122.144.128.34 123.232.30.126 122.198.191.67 122.49.189.124 117.59.32.46 202.164.15.190 119.27.64.188 202.93.74.197 61.47.128.20 202.69.4.23 221.133.224.235 116.2.169.106